Mercury in PDB 7v39: Crystal Structure of Np Exonuclease-Pcmb Complex

Protein crystallography data

The structure of Crystal Structure of Np Exonuclease-Pcmb Complex, PDB code: 7v39 was solved by Y.Y.Hsiao, K.W.Huang,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 28.82 / 2.20
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 50.185, 76.292, 140.784, 90, 90, 90
R / Rfree (%) 20 / 23

Other elements in 7v39:

The structure of Crystal Structure of Np Exonuclease-Pcmb Complex also contains other interesting chemical elements:

Zinc (Zn) 2 atoms
